Amancio (Spanish pronunciation: [aˈmansjo]) is a municipality and town in the Las Tunas Province of Cuba. It is located in the south-western part of the province, and opens to the Gulf of Guacanayabo to the south.
Demographics
In 2022, Amancio had a population of 36,132.[2] With a total area of 857 km2 (331 sq mi),[1] it has a population density of 48.5/km2 (126/sq mi).
